策略模式

2021-08-02 18:08:11 12 举报
策略模式是一种行为型设计模式,它定义了一系列算法,并将每个算法封装起来,使它们可以互相替换,且算法的变化不会影响到使用算法的客户端。策略模式让算法独立于使用它的客户端。在策略模式中,一个类的行为或其算法可以在运行时更改。这使得算法可以独立于使用它的客户端变化。策略模式通常用于实现一系列算法,将每一个算法封装起来并可以相互替换。策略模式让算法独立于使用它的客户端,避免客户端与多个算法直接耦合。
Java设计模式
作者其他创作
大纲/内容
评论
0 条评论
下一页